def test_typical():
    """Representative small input works."""
    text = TextBody("whale eats captain")
    assert_(text.words, ['whale', 'eats', 'captain'])
def test_biggest():
    """An entire book works."""
    text = TextBody(open('moby_dick.txt').read())
    assert_(text.word_number, 200000)
def test_smallest():
    """Minimal string works."""
    text = TextBody("whale")
    assert_(text.words, ['whale'])
def test_empty():
    """Empty input works"""
    text = TextBody('')
    assert_(text.word_number, 0)
